Innovative Charging Solutions on Display
At the forefront of this year's exhibition are groundbreaking technologies that aim to optimize the performance of charging stations. Kehua's introduction of an 800kW distributed system marks a significant step forward. This system not only improves charging speeds but also supports a wider range of electric vehicles, catering to both consumer and commercial sectors.
Benefits of 800kW Distributed Systems
- Faster Charging Times: The 800kW capacity enables quicker charge cycles, reducing wait times for EV users.
- Versatile Applications: Suitable for various vehicle types, promoting broader adoption of EVs.
- Scalability: Easily integrates into existing infrastructures, allowing for future upgrades as demand grows.
Integrating Renewable Energy Sources
One of the highlights of Kehua's showcase was the integration of photovoltaic energy storage systems (PV-ESS). This technology allows for the harnessing of solar energy to power charging stations, making EV charging more sustainable and environmentally friendly.
Advantages of PV-ESS Integration
- Reduced Energy Costs: Utilizing solar energy can significantly lower operational costs for charging stations.
- Environmental Impact: By using renewable energy, the carbon footprint of EV charging is minimized.
- Energy Independence: Charging stations can become less reliant on grid power, enhancing energy security.
